Systems and Methods for Enhancing Responsiveness to Utterances Having Detectable Emotion
First Claim
1. A method comprising:
- receiving, via a user device, a natural utterance, the natural utterance including at least one emotion feature;
extracting the at least one emotion feature from the natural utterance;
mapping each of the at least one emotion feature to an emotion;
inferring, based on the emotion, an inferred command of the natural utterance; and
responding to the natural utterance at least by one or both of;
1) performing an action corresponding to the inferred command; and
2) providing a verbalized acknowledgement of the natural utterance adapted to the emotion.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ods, systems, and related products that provide emotion-sensitive responses to user'"'"'s commands and other utterances received at an utterance-based user interface. Acknowledgements of user'"'"'s utterances are adapted to the user and/or the user device, and emotions detected in the user'"'"'s utterance that have been mapped from one or more emotion features extracted from the utterance. In some examples, extraction of a user'"'"'s changing emotion during a sequence of interactions is used to generate a response to a user'"'"'s uttered command. In some examples, emotion processing and command processing of natural utterances are performed asynchronously.
-
Citations
15 Claims
-
1. A method comprising:
-
receiving, via a user device, a natural utterance, the natural utterance including at least one emotion feature; extracting the at least one emotion feature from the natural utterance; mapping each of the at least one emotion feature to an emotion; inferring, based on the emotion, an inferred command of the natural utterance; and responding to the natural utterance at least by one or both of;
1) performing an action corresponding to the inferred command; and
2) providing a verbalized acknowledgement of the natural utterance adapted to the emotion.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
-
15. A non-transitory computer readable medium comprising:
-
an emotion processor having one or more sequences of emotion processor instructions that, when executed by one or more processors, causes the one or more processors to generate an output adapted to an emotion detected in a natural utterance; and one or more sequences of instructions which, when executed by one or more processors, cause the one or processors to; receive, via a user device, a natural utterance, the natural utterance including at least one emotion feature; extract the at least one emotion feature from the natural utterance; map each of the at least one emotion feature to an emotion; infer, based on the emotion, an inferred command of the natural utterance; and respond to the natural utterance at least by one or both of;
1) performing an action corresponding to the inferred command; and
2) providing a verbalized acknowledgement of the natural utterance adapted to the emotion.
-
Specification